Initial public offering
An initial public offering (also known as a stock launch) is when a company offers shares of its company to institutional and retail investors. An investment bank arranges for the company's shares being listed on the stock market. Shareholders buy the shares to reap the benefits of their growth potential. Market makers
Market makers refer to high-volume traders participating in the stock trading market. Market makers may influence how a stock does in the stock exchange by posting bids or offers. Each investment requires a buyer to sell it. Market makers can help investors find buyers and sellers so that they can buy or sell a stock. But how does it work in a stock market? Interest rates
Many investors have questions about the effects of interest rate changes on the stock exchange. The Federal Reserve determines interest rates to keep inflation under control and to promote full employment. The Federal Reserve adjusts the federal funds interest rate in increments up to 0.25 percent. The stock market is affected by more than just the interest rate. The Federal Reserve Open Market Committee (which consists 12 members) makes decisions about interest rate on an 8-week cycle. If they feel that the situation warrants a change, they may affect the stock markets immediately.

What is the difference between a broker and a financial advisor?
Brokers are specialists in the sale and purchase of stocks and other securities for individuals and companies. They take care all of the paperwork.
Financial advisors can help you make informed decisions about your personal finances. They help clients plan for retirement and prepare for emergency situations to reach their financial goals.
Banks, insurers and other institutions can employ financial advisors. They may also work as independent professionals for a fee.
